Output 669754626b073d01819749cfe1f1718fc73ee9ddac3496835937bab5f490577c:31

value
10799866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 143bc25887ef58646328e43be10b4489723a3223 OP_EQUALVERIFY OP_CHECKSIG
address
12qz6ycWHn8mB5L7dtTVqCDASdPLLTRvq8
transaction
669754626b073d01819749cfe1f1718fc73ee9ddac3496835937bab5f490577c
spent
true